In plain words
This tool analyzes companies through their job postings to create quick company profiles for job seekers preparing for interviews. Users can view hiring trends and insights for specific organizations, with example profiles available for companies like OpenAI and Advanced Micro Devices. The creator notes the data quality is still under development, making it a work-in-progress resource for those seeking a snapshot of company hiring patterns and focus areas.

Hi HN! A few days ago I saw a graph[0] that showed the # of job postings on HN was declining. I started wondering what other trends I could glean from the data, so I created this! You can filter through the top level comments by keyword; for example you can filter by "remote" to see the massive spike around March 2020. Another interesting thing I found is that I can compare hiring across cities. I hope you enjoy! Hi HN! While Glassdoor and other employment discussion boards offer valuable interview experience data, navigating it to prepare for interviews can be difficult. Onsites.fyi curates interview experiences and insights from Big Tech hiring across various positions and levels. Our collection currently includes interview experiences from top-tier companies like Apple, Google, Meta, Microsoft, and Amazon.
